$525k Salary — Complete Guide

Yearly perspective — what is $525k a year?

At $525k/year, you're looking at $43,750/month before taxes — or $252.40 per hour over a 2,080-hour work year.

Monthly lifestyle — $525k a year is how much a month?

Your gross monthly pay on a $525k salary is $43,750. After federal and Texas taxes, you can expect to take home around $29,666 each month.

Weekly and hourly breakdown

A $525k annual salary pays $10,096 per week and $20,192 each biweekly pay period. Your equivalent hourly rate is $252.40.

After-tax income estimate

In Texas, a $525k salary yields approximately $355,993 per year after all taxes — an effective rate of around 32.2%. No state income tax. Actual take-home pay may vary by state and filing status.

Is $525k a Good Salary?

$525k is in the top 5% of US earners. This is a high income by any measure — financial flexibility is strong.

Whether it's "good" also depends heavily on where you live. In low-cost states like Mississippi or Arkansas, $525k provides comfortable financial security for most lifestyles. In San Francisco or Manhattan, the same salary stretches much less far in real purchasing power.
